ACS714 Automotive Grade, Fully Integrated, Hall-Effect-Based Linear Current Sensor IC with 2.1 kVRMS Voltage Isolation and Low-Resistance Current Cond.
The Allegro™ ACS714 provides economical and precise solutions for AC or DC current sensing in automotive systems.

Features

* ▪ Low-noise analog signal path ▪ Device bandwidth is set via the FILTER pin ▪ 5 µs output rise time in response to step input current ▪ 80 kHz bandwidth ▪ Total output error 1.5% typical, at TA = 25°C ▪ Small footprint, low-profile SOIC8 package ▪ 1.2 mΩ internal conductor resistance ▪ 2.1 kVRMS min

Applications

* include motor control, load detection and management, switch-mode power supplies, and overcurrent fault protection.
